DISPLAY DEVICE BY BLOW MOLDING
PROBLEM TO BE SOLVED: To provide a display device such as standing signboards by blow molding, the device that is manufactured efficiently and can be changed in a size and configuration.SOLUTION: A main body 1 formed in a shape of a flat hollow by blow molding is integrally formed of a lower structure such as legs 3 in one end of a flat plate part 2 for disposing a display object A. In the other end of the main body, a connection part 4 that is a structure capable of being connected by being opposed is formed, and a superstructure with the connection part 4 having the structure capable of being connected by being opposed to the connection part 4 of the main body 1 is connected. The connection part is formed of an engaging projection 12 being in a range of 1/2 of any one of the left and right of the width, and in the range of 1/2 of any one of the front and rear of the thickness. The connection part is formed of an engaging recess 13 having a size to engage the engaging projection 12 being in the range of 1/2 of any other of the left and right of the width, and in the range of 1/2 of any other of the front and rear of the thickness.SELECTED DRAWING: Figure 1
